Web6 Aug 2024 · Lemon Button fern likes rich, moist, and slightly acidic soil. It will only need 4 hours of bright indirect light per day. It should be watered moderately once the top two inches of soil dry out. The optimum temperature range is 60-80°F (15-27°C). It likes to have 70% or higher atmospheric humidity.

You should purchase a soluble (liquid), all-purpose fertilizer. Make sure to dilute the fertilizer to ½ strength. During the period of growth, March to August, you will need to fertilize every three to four weeks. After that, fertilizing monthly should be adequate.
